Sports Update
HMS Athletic Update
January 2024
Henderson Middle School is in the Middle Georgia Middle School Athletic League. The league consists of Clifton Ridge, Gray Station, Upson Lee, Pike County, Lamar County, Monroe County and Jasper County.
HMS Basketball- The HMS basketball teams traveled to Clifton Ridge on Wednesday 01/17 and the girls won by a score of 26-11 and the boys were defeated by a score 37-21. The teams traveled to Upson Lee on Thursday 01/18 and the girls were defeated by a score of 37-30 and the boys won a close one 51-50. Next up for the boys will be a make-up game against Pike County @ home on Monday 01/22 beginning @ 5 pm and the final home game will be on Tues. 01/23 @ 5 pm vs. Gray Station.
HMS Wrestling- HMS wrestling season has completed. Thank you to Coach Flake and Coach Vick for your work with our wrestlers.
HMS Cheer- The HMS cheer team was on hand for the basketball games against Clifton Ridge and Upson Lee and performed very well. The girls continue to work hard daily on the court and in the school. Go Tigers!
HMS Baseball- HMS baseball tryouts have concluded and the Tigers have begun practicing. The weather has obviously made it a challenge for our baseball team but they have been able to go inside and get some work done. The team had a parent meeting at HMS on 11/18 and the first game is scheduled for 02/06 @ Lamar County. The HMS team has three 8th graders, eight 7th graders and eight 6th graders. HMS has seven 8th graders that will be playing on the JV team at the high school.
HMS Soccer- HMS soccer teams began practicing this week also in the frigid temperatures. The teams are working hard and the first scheduled match will be on 02/05 @ Upson Lee beginning at 5 pm.
HMS Volleyball- HMS Volleyball- Sorry for the misinformation last week! Tryouts for HMS Volleyball will be 02/05-02/07 from 3:30-5:30 in the HMS gym. In order to be eligible to try out the girls must have a current physical on file and BCSS consent paperwork completed and turned in to Coach Hall. Students must have passed 5 out of 6 classes for the 1st semester. For girls that make the team there will be a Player/Parent Meeting on 02/08 in the HMS cafeteria @ 6 pm.
HMS Track- The HMS track teams began practicing at the Butts County Athletic Complex on 01/18. The coaches held a parent meeting at Jackson High School on 01/18 @ 6 pm. The first meet is scheduled at home on 02/29 beginning at 4 pm alongside Jackson High School.
